I have several root partitions. With TW XFCE the NetworkManager GUI allows me to add a bridge. With TW GNOME/KDE the GUI allows just some sort of VPN. I compared package lists in each one, there is no obvious difference. All 'rpm -qa | grep -i netwo' gives similar results, bridge-utils is also installed. Does anyone happen to know how NetworkManager GUI decides when 'Adding Bridge..' is supposed to be shown? Olaf
